What is Orientation- object-oriented technology
There are many characteristics of object-oriented technology. A few of these characteristics have been discussed in course MCS-024. We have also executed some of them in Java programming language, although these qualities are not sole to object-oriented systems in the sense that they differ from object based systems to object oriented systems. However, most of the characteristics are mostly well supported in object oriented systems. Now, let us discuss about the basic properties around which object oriented systems are created.
